Summary |
"The scientific exploration of the origins of life is a multidisciplinary and interdisciplinary field, with information from sources such as biology, geology, astronomy, physics, planetary science, and chemistry. Chemistry is specifically well-oriented to provide an understanding of how life arose since life is primarily a materialistic phenomenon, in which chemicals react in a certain way through the addition of physicochemical energy. This primer is aimed at graduate students who are beginning experiments in origins of life studies and more experienced chemists who would like to gain some understanding of the geology and geochemistry of the early earth."-- Provided by publisher |
